The Story

Kayon Mountain is a 500 hectare farm, owned and operated by Ismael Hassen Aredo and his family since 2012. The farm stretches across the villages of Taro and Sewana in the Guji zone of Shakiso, an area renowned for producing amazing coffees.

Ismael leads with both vision and care. Alongside his 25 full time staff and 300 seasonal pickers, he invests deeply in his community, funding schools, supporting local infrastructure, and paying higher wages to ensure skilled pickers return year after year. It’s this combination of social responsibility and dedication to quality that has made Kayon Mountain a consistent favourite in our lineup.

This release marks a first for us: an anaerobic natural process lot from Kayon Mountain, elevated into our Motive Series for its stunning complexity. Ripe cherries are sealed in airtight tanks for a carefully controlled 7-day fermentation. Oxygen-free and temperature-stabilized in concrete water baths, the slow process transforms the coffee, building layers of vibrant flavor.
